Gabriel Rosenstock

    Rosenstock je především uznávaným básníkem, jehož dílo přesahuje sto svazků v oblasti poezie i překladu. Jeho literární přínos se projevuje v různých formách, včetně prózy a dramatu, ale jeho hlavní doménou zůstává poezie. Rosenstockův hlas je pro čtenáře neodmyslitelnou součástí irské literární scény.

      Gabriel Rosenstock reimagines extracts from Kropotkin's Mutual Aid, transforming them into bilingual 'Whitmanesque Cantos for the Future of Man.' This work emphasizes themes of cooperation and solidarity, presenting a fresh perspective on Kropotkin’s ideas. The poetic format aims to inspire readers by blending philosophical insights with lyrical expression, making the text accessible and relevant for contemporary audiences.

      Drawing inspiration from the Sufi figure of Mullah Nasrudin, these tales feature clever twists and humorous surprises that challenge conventional wisdom. The stories celebrate the wit and wisdom of the wise fool, providing readers with thought-provoking and entertaining narratives. A playful warning humorously notes the inclusion of "nuts," hinting at the quirky and unpredictable nature of the tales.

      Engaging deeply with Eastern poetry, this collection reflects a dialogue with the spirit of the tragic poet Li He. Through lyrical conversations, readers are transported to a vivid world filled with sensory experiences like plum blossoms and courtesans' perfume. The poems evoke an ancient landscape marked by war, drought, and plague, resonating with contemporary issues. Both the original Irish and the English translations by Gary Bannister capture the beauty and depth of Rosenstock's work, creating a celestial connection through exquisite language.

      Forty-two black and white photographs from around the world, accompanied by poetry by the Irish poet, Gabriel Rosenstock. Duotone printing by Mercantile/Image Press, West Boylston, Massachusetts. A limited edition of 1,000 copies were printed, all signed and numbered. Half of the edition sold the first year.
